Wait, do these places really sell strategy guides for 1 cent? I have never seen this before, do they usually sell out really fast??
Life is like a hurricane...
Not really. If you get lucky you may get a cashier that is clueless or doesn't care and will sell them to you for .01 (or give them to you). At GS I hear you can improve your odds by offering to put down a pre-order; cashiers there are evaluated on pre-orders, so this can go a long way. It costs you $5, but depending on the guide/amount, could be totally worth it. But the vast majority of the time the guides will have been taken off the floor like they are supposed to or they just won't sell them to you at all.

So this is most likely a wasted effort that almost never works. When you do get there and they have a penny guide out on the floor, do you just bring it up to the counter and have them ring it up like normal?
Life is like a hurricane...
It isn't a waste of time for me. I've been getting pennied out guides for the better part of the last decade. Every store is different but I have no problem getting them from Best Buy(mostly) and occassionally Gamestop. And yes, you just take them up to the counter and they get ringed as usual. Of the 10+ times I've gotten guides last year, only one time a clueless cashier didn't know what to do and called for assistance. But their "help" just assured them it was ok and rang my guides up. Atleast around here some of the Best Buys even make .01 price tags so you know which guides are clearanced(although they usually hold the good guides in the back for themselves).
